Free release

10184-66-4 dimethyl (1-hydroxyethyl)phosphonate

service@apichina.com
Product Name dimethyl (1-hydroxyethyl)phosphonate
CAS No. 10184-66-4
Synonyms Dimethyl (1-hydroxyethyl)phosphonate
InChI InChI=1/C4H11O4P/c1-4(5)9(6,7-2)8-3/h4-5H,1-3H3
Molecular Formula C4H11O4P
Molecular Weight 154.1015
Density 1.191g/cm3
Boiling point 213.6°C at 760 mmHg
Flash point 83°C
Refractive index 1.415